What is Sainsbury (J) Equity-to-Asset?

Equity to Asset ratio is calculated as total stockholders equity divided by total asset. Sainsbury (J)'s Total Stockholders Equity for the quarter that ended in Feb. 2024 was $8,672 Mil. Sainsbury (J)'s Total Assets for the quarter that ended in Feb. 2024 was $31,643 Mil. Therefore, Sainsbury (J)'s Equity to Asset Ratio for the quarter that ended in Feb. 2024 was 0.27.

Sainsbury (J) Equity-to-Asset Calculation

Equity to Asset ratio measures the ratios of the portion of the asset owned by shareholders out of the total asset. It indicates the leverage of the company, and the amount of debt the company uses in its operation.

Equity to Asset ratio is calculated by dividing total stockholders equity by total asset.

Sainsbury (J)'s Equity to Asset Ratio for the fiscal year that ended in Feb. 2023 is calculated as

Equity to Asset (A: Feb. 2023 )=Total Stockholders Equity/Total Assets
=8759.662/31591.787
=0.28

Sainsbury (J)'s Equity to Asset Ratio for the quarter that ended in Feb. 2024 is calculated as

Equity to Asset (Q: Feb. 2024 )=Total Stockholders Equity/Total Assets
=8671.717/31642.677
=0.27

Sainsbury (J)  (OTCPK:JSAIY) Equity-to-Asset Explanation

Equity to Asset ratio can vary greatly across different industries, as they have different capital structure. A company with smaller Equity to Asset ratio (more leveraged) may have higher ROE % because of the leverage.

For banks, the required minimum Equity to Asset ratio by regulation is 5%. Some stronger banks may have Equity to Asset Ratio of more than 10%.

Founded in 1869, Sainsbury's is the second-largest U.K. grocery chain with around 16% market share. It operates around 600 supermarkets and 800 convenience stores, all in the U.K. The company has diversified away from core food by selling clothing, telecom equipment, and other nonfood items. In September 2016, it took a step further into nonfood retailing with the purchase of Home Retail Group, operating the Habitat and Argos chains (general merchandise and electronics stores), for GBP 1.10 billion. It has been selling products online since 1997.
